Compare all specifications:
1998 Mazda 323 | 2005 SsangYong Musso | |
Make | Mazda | SsangYong |
Model | 323 | Musso |
Year Released | 1998 | 2005 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 1840 cc | 2874 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 5 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 114 HP | 118 HP |
Engine RPM | 6000 RPM | 4100 RPM |
Torque | 162 Nm | 245 Nm |
Torque RPM | 4000 RPM | 2400 RPM |
Engine Bore Size | 83 mm | 89 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 85 mm | 92.4 mm |
Engine Compression Ratio | 9.7:1 | 22.0:1 |
Drive Type | Front | 4WD |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 3 seats |
Number of Doors | 4 doors | 4 doors |
Vehicle Length | 4320 mm | 4940 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1710 mm | 1870 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1420 mm | 1770 mm |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 55 L | 80 L |
